A winch plays a crucial role in ensuring that payloads are securely managed before and after their release. By employing a reliable winch, operators can control the descent of the payload with precision and ensure that it lands exactly where intended. The correct winch system not only helps in lowering the payload safely but can also facilitate the fine adjustments needed throughout the drop process. This control mechanism can significantly reduce the chance of mishaps during the release operation.
One of the foremost considerations when preparing for a payload release is the weight and size of the item being dropped. Items that are too heavy or aerodynamically poor can behave unpredictably. When operating at heights of 300 meters, the wind can also play a significant role in altering the trajectory of the payload. This is where a well-calibrated winch can help; it can allow operators to test various methods of deployment, ensuring that the release process is smooth and controlled.
Moreover, understanding the physics behind the drop is essential. As the height increases, the influence of gravity will also cause the payload to accelerate. An optimal winch system can counteract this acceleration by allowing for gradual release, reducing the impact forces experienced by both the payload and the target area. Operators can simulate various drop conditions using advanced software tools, making it possible to design a system that accommodates variations in weight and environmental factors.
Safety is paramount in any payload release operation, especially when dealing with heights that could result in injury or equipment damage. Proper training on how to use a winch effectively and safely is essential for all involved personnel. Having protocols in place for different scenarios can mitigate risks and ensure that all team members are prepared for any eventuality.

Another critical aspect of enhancing a payload release system is the integration of technology. Modern advancements like drones and automated release systems are transforming the landscape of aerial logistics. Drone technology, in particular, can be paired with winches to add an extra layer of precision when releasing payloads from high altitudes. Using automated systems ensures that the payload is released at the exact moment calculated, making operations more efficient and more reliable.
